Tdap Immunizations for Every Pregnancy?

The Center for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) immunization schedule was updated in January, 2013 to recommend that a dose of Tdap vaccine be administered to all pregnant women during each pregnancy whether or not they have received the vaccine previously.  This is a new recommendation. Support Labeling for Genetically Modified Foods

On November 6, 2012, California voters will be voting on Proposition 37.  Proposition 37, if passed, would require food labeling for genetically modified foods.  A ‘yes’ vote would favor the new food labeling laws.
